Life Republic integrates sustainable architecture from the ground up. Key practices include:
✅ Solar panels installed across multiple sectors of the township
✅ Seamless airflow and natural ventilation through optimized orientation and window placement.
✅ Tower placement designed to create open spaces and ensure ample airflow, maintaining lower ambient temperatures across the township.
These strategies reduce energy demand and enhance occupant comfort.
✅ Rainwater harvesting systems at building and community level capture monsoon water for reuse in landscaping and non-potable applications.
✅ Sewage Treatment Plants (STP) treat wastewater within the township, reducing dependency on municipal supply and protecting local groundwater.
✅ Greywater recycling is also employed, enabling reuse for flushing, gardening, and washing outdoors.
✅ Installations of rooftop solar panels for common areas (clubhouse, street lighting) offset energy costs.
✅ Provision of 24x7 power backup ensures that sustainable systems (pumps, water treatment) continue functioning during outages.
By combining solar and backup, Life Republic enhances reliability and reduces carbon footprint.

✅ Cost premium upfront: Green materials and systems are costlier initially
✅ Maintenance complexity: Systems like STP, rainwater networks require skilled upkeep
✅ Behavior adoption: Residents must adapt to sustainable habits (e.g. separating waste)
